does conquer empty battlefield count as win combat?

No. Conquering an empty battlefield is not considered winning a combat — no Combat occurred.
Combat only happens when opposing players have units at the same battlefield (Rule 438/461). Moving to an empty battlefield creates a Non-Combat Showdown, which closes without a combat result (Rule 348.2). You still establish control and Conquer (scoring the point), but because there was no Combat Showdown, there's no attacker/defender, no combat winner, and no Combat Cleanup (units don't heal).
